Factors Influencing Flight Schedules
Several factors can influence the flight schedules of both Air Canada and Israir Airlines. Understanding these elements can help you anticipate potential changes and plan your travel more effectively. Firstly, seasonal demand plays a huge role. During peak travel seasons, such as summer and major holidays, airlines often increase the frequency of flights to accommodate the higher number of passengers. Conversely, during off-peak seasons, flight schedules may be reduced. Global events and geopolitical situations can also significantly impact flight schedules. Events such as political instability, health crises, or economic downturns can lead to changes in travel demand and, consequently, flight availability. Airlines must remain flexible and adapt their schedules to reflect these changing circumstances. Regulatory changes and government policies are another critical factor. New aviation regulations, travel restrictions, or visa requirements can all affect the ease and feasibility of operating flights between countries. Airlines must comply with these regulations, which may sometimes result in adjustments to their schedules. Economic factors, such as fuel prices and exchange rates, can also influence flight schedules. Higher fuel costs can make certain routes less profitable, leading airlines to reduce flight frequency or even suspend service altogether. Similarly, fluctuations in exchange rates can affect the affordability of travel, impacting demand and flight schedules. Finally, operational challenges, such as maintenance requirements and crew availability, can cause unexpected changes to flight schedules. Airlines must ensure that their aircraft are well-maintained and that they have sufficient staff to operate flights safely and efficiently. Any disruptions in these areas can lead to delays or cancellations. By keeping these factors in mind, you can better understand the dynamics of flight schedules and be prepared for potential changes. Tips for Booking Flights to Israel
Booking flights to Israel, whether with Air Canada, Israir, or any other airline, requires some savvy planning to ensure you get the best deals and a smooth travel experience. Here are some essential tips to help you along the way. First, book in advance. Generally, the earlier you book your flight, the better the chances of securing lower fares. Airlines often offer discounted prices for tickets purchased well ahead of the travel date, so try to plan your trip as early as possible. Be flexible with your travel dates. If you have some flexibility in your schedule, experiment with different dates to see if you can find lower fares. Mid-week flights (Tuesday, Wednesday, and Thursday) are often cheaper than weekend flights. Consider flying during the off-season. Traveling during the off-season can not only save you money on flights but also on accommodation and other travel expenses. Israel has a mild climate, so even during the shoulder seasons (spring and fall), you can enjoy pleasant weather and fewer crowds. Use flight comparison websites. Several websites allow you to compare prices from multiple airlines at once. This can help you quickly identify the cheapest options and find the best deals. Some popular flight comparison websites include Google Flights, Skyscanner, and Kayak. Also, be aware of baggage fees. Many airlines charge extra for checked baggage, so factor this into your overall cost. Check the airline's baggage policy before you book your ticket to avoid any surprises at the airport. Finally, sign up for airline newsletters and alerts. Airlines often send out special promotions and discounts to their email subscribers. By signing up for these newsletters, you can stay informed about the latest deals and potentially snag a great price on your flight to Israel. What to Expect at Israeli Airports
Navigating airports can be a bit stressful, so knowing what to expect at Israeli airports can make your travel experience much smoother. Whether you're arriving or departing, here's a rundown of what you need to know. Security is a top priority at Israeli airports. You can expect thorough security checks, which may include questioning by security personnel, baggage inspections, and body scans. Be prepared to answer questions about the purpose of your visit, your travel history, and who packed your bags. Arriving at Ben Gurion Airport (TLV), the main international airport in Israel, you'll find efficient immigration and customs procedures. Make sure you have your passport and any necessary visas ready for inspection. After clearing immigration, you'll proceed to baggage claim, where you can retrieve your luggage. Customs officials may conduct random checks of your belongings. Inside the airport, you'll find a variety of amenities, including shops, restaurants, and currency exchange services. Wi-Fi is available throughout the airport, allowing you to stay connected. When departing from Ben Gurion Airport, it's recommended to arrive at least three hours before your scheduled flight. This will give you ample time to complete the security procedures and check-in. Be prepared for additional security screening, which may include an interview with security personnel. After clearing security, you'll have access to a wide range of duty-free shops, restaurants, and lounges. The airport also offers services such as baggage wrapping and porter assistance. Accessibility services are available for passengers with disabilities. If you require assistance, it's best to inform your airline in advance. The airport is equipped with ramps, elevators, and accessible restrooms. Overall, Israeli airports prioritize security and efficiency.
